Output 26c9717a35ddbd7a566054ab6dbbfdb801b2b4092090a34bbd053f04f3b76615:1

value
47803896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66a74d809971c845f87cfd485f843633ec964b6 OP_EQUAL
address
3Q9wgTPp9fXYYS1TRhEt1YuLFykFX44hwA
transaction
26c9717a35ddbd7a566054ab6dbbfdb801b2b4092090a34bbd053f04f3b76615
spent
true